SD24B/0057 is a planning application for permission at 11 Moyle Crescent, Clondalkin, D22 WR90, received by South Dublin County Council on 21 Feb 2024 and first seen by Planning Register on 11 Sept 2026. The application describes: Widening of driveway entrance. Rear flat roof ground floor extension and associated internal alterations. Flat roof front porch to integrate partial conversion to garage. The council granted permission on 10 Apr 2024. The five-week observation window closed on 27 Mar 2024. A commencement notice (CN0116459SD) was lodged on 9 Jul 2024, so works have started on site. The site is zoned G1 — open space with recreation under the South Dublin County Council development plan. Within 500 m there are 109 other decided applications in the last five years and 10 appeals.

R2 — Existing residential

RES: To protect and/or improve residential amenity

An established residential area. The objective is to protect existing residential amenity as well as to provide housing — which is the objective a neighbour's objection to an overbearing extension is usually argued under.
